Purpose

African Journal of Education and Social Sciences (AJESS) is peer reviewed and multidisciplinary in nature and seeks to publish original research and academic scholarship that contributes to the growth of knowledge in Education and extended fields of social science. AJESS is a quarterly publication. In exceptional cases, special edition may be done once in a year.

Scope

AJESS provides a forum for the sharing of the wide ranging and independent latest theories, applications, and services related to planning, developing, managing, using, and evaluating of education and social sciences.

It covers the following aspects among others:Administration & policy in education, Curriculum, instruction & assessment, Global & comparative education, Higher education, Multicultural education, Technology & E-learning, Vocational education & training, Humanities, Sociology, Gender studies & social justice, Social change & policy, Race & ethnic studies, Crime & law, Culture, ethics and religion, Knowledge, information, media, & Communication, Work, economy & organizations and Community development
